Outsourcing Plans for China
China, also known as the manufacturing central of Asia recently announced their plans to join the outsourcing wagon.

Ma Xiuhong,the Vice minister of Commerce explained that by joining the outsourcing industry, they would be able to "improve the quality of foreign trade in China" and in upgrading the state of China's foreign investments.

Li Zhiqun, director of the MOC's Foreign Investment Administration Department remarked that the Ministry of Commerce (MOC) would allocate money for the said plan. The money would be used in training workers fit for the outsourcing industry as well as in establishing structures which would accommodate interested parties in the coming years.

In addition to this, Zhiquin pointed out that IPR in China would be improved to provide better outsourcing services to outsourcing firms and vendors alike.
